One day free doesn't really give you many options. There's some nice little day trips a few miles outside of Madurai that you could do. Look here http://www.madurai.com/
If you check the "how to get there section and check Bus timings, it's only like 4 hours to places like Rameswarem, Kodaikanal and Thekkady. You could leave on a late afternoon bus and come back the next night. Plus also ask the people where your interning. |
